Customer service response "Thank you for being our customer and sharing your concern along with a photo; we appreciate it. As small pet parents ourselves, we understand your concern for your little one which is why we always recommend checking everything you feed them, just like you would for yourself. While it is a rare occurrence, hay is bound so tightly during the harvest baling process that the twine can snap resulting in the twine getting baled in with the hay. We don't always see what's inside the layers.
It will not hurt your pet to pull it out, nor is it at risk of contaminating the hay. Baling twine is purposely a bright blue so it can be easily seen when feeding pets/livestock making it easier to pick out.
As a friendly disclaimer, we advise our customers, to open and inspect all packages even if you don't need them right away. This helps ensure all issues (i.e., missing items, delivery issues, product concerns) are reported within 14 days of placing your order. Here's the full Small Pet Select return policy."

I've revised my listing from three stars to five. I ordered a 50lb box of Orchard grass. When it arrived, I noticed that there were "pricker weeds" in with the Orchard grass. This presents a real threat to my Guinea pigs as cuts in the mouth can easily get infected. (We lost a beloved piggy this way.) I contacted Small Pet Select and they sent an new 50lb box free of charge, I'm really happy with the product and the company.
